Whispers of Your Strands: Understanding the Delicate Ecosystem of Your Hair

Before we dissect the technology, let’s spend a moment with the star of the show: your hair. Each strand, seemingly simple, is a marvel of biological engineering. The outermost layer, the cuticle, acts like a protective shield, composed of tiny, overlapping scales, much like shingles on a roof or the scales of a fish. When these cuticles are lying flat and smooth, they lock in moisture, reflect light (hello, shine!), and protect the inner core. Beneath this shield lies the cortex, the main body of the hair shaft. It’s made up of long keratin protein fibers and contains the pigment that gives your hair its color, as well as the crucial moisture that keeps it supple and elastic.

A “good hair day” often boils down to how happy these cuticles are. Factors like moisture balance and pH play a significant role. Hair is naturally slightly acidic, and this acidity helps keep the cuticles closed and compact. When hair becomes too alkaline, or when it’s stripped of its natural oils and moisture, the cuticles can lift and open up. This leads to a rougher surface, tangles, dullness, and, crucially, moisture loss from the cortex, making the hair brittle and prone to breakage.

And what’s a primary antagonist in this delicate ecosystem? Uncontrolled heat. While heat is essential for styling and speeding up drying by evaporating water, excessive or poorly distributed heat can be incredibly damaging. It can boil the water within the hair shaft, creating damaging steam pockets, degrade the keratin proteins, and force those protective cuticles wide open, leaving your hair vulnerable and parched.

The Genesis of Nanoe™: More Than Just an Ion

So, what exactly is a “Nanoe”? According to Panasonic, this technology involves a sophisticated process. The dryer draws in ambient moisture from the air around you. Then, a high-voltage electrical discharge is applied to this collected moisture, atomizing it into incredibly fine, electrostatically charged water particles – these are the Nanoe™ particles. The “nano” in their name refers to their minuscule size, which is key to their efficacy.

A critical distinction Panasonic makes is the moisture content: Nanoe™ particles are said to contain approximately 1,000 times more moisture by volume than the standard negative ions found in many conventional ionic hair dryers. Think of negative ions as a light mist, whereas Nanoe™ particles are more like microscopic, super-hydrating dew drops. Furthermore, these particles are claimed to be mildly acidic, with a pH level around 5.5. This is significant because this pH is very close to the natural, healthy acidity of both hair and scalp, a condition that encourages cuticles to remain smoothly closed.

The Unseen Assistant – The Nanoe™ Charge Panel

Adding another layer of sophistication, the EH-ANA6HN (and its technological sibling, the EH-NA67, whose manual details this feature) incorporates what Panasonic calls the “Nanoe™ Charge System.” This involves a dedicated panel on the handle of the dryer. When you grip the handle, this panel purportedly helps to release any excess negative electrical charge that may have accumulated on your hair. Hair, especially when dry, can easily pick up static. If your hair is already negatively charged, it might repel the similarly negatively charged Nanoe™ particles. By neutralizing this static buildup on the hair, the panel creates a more receptive surface, allowing the Nanoe™ particles to be more effectively drawn to and absorbed by each strand. It’s a subtle but clever piece of engineering, turning a simple act of holding the dryer into an interactive part of the conditioning process.

The Static Quo Challenged: The Perils of Concentrated Heat

Traditional hair dryers often deliver a concentrated, static blast of hot air. While this might seem like the fastest way to dry a section of hair, it carries a significant risk. Holding a powerful heat source too close or too long on one area can rapidly overheat those strands and the underlying scalp. This leads to those dreaded “hot spots,” causing localized damage, moisture evaporation that outpaces any conditioning effect, and potential scalp irritation or even burns. It’s a bit like trying to toast bread with a blowtorch – you might get a quick char, but it’s far from an even, golden brown.

The Dance of the Nozzle: Constant Motion, Constant Care

Panasonic’s solution is an elegantly simple yet highly effective mechanical innovation: a nozzle that doesn’t just sit still, but actively moves. The Oscillating Quick-Dry Nozzle automatically sways back and forth, distributing the airflow and heat over a much wider area of hair with each pass.

The science behind this “dance” is rooted in fundamental principles of heat transfer and airflow dynamics.

  • Even Heat Distribution: By constantly moving, the nozzle prevents the prolonged concentration of heat on any single spot. Think of a skilled painter applying even coats of paint, rather than letting it pool in one area. This significantly reduces the risk of thermal damage to both the hair shaft and the sensitive scalp. Your hair gets dry, not fried.
  • Enhanced Drying Efficiency: The oscillating motion effectively increases the surface area of hair that is exposed to optimal drying conditions at any given moment. This, combined with the powerful 1875-watt motor, can lead to faster overall drying times, not by using harsher heat, but by using heat and air more intelligently. The gentle agitation of the hair by the moving airflow might also help to separate strands slightly, allowing heated air to circulate more freely and moisture to evaporate more readily from all sides of the hair shaft.
  • Scalp Comfort: A significant user-reported benefit, and a logical consequence of even heat distribution, is increased scalp comfort. The constant movement of the nozzle prevents that intense, focused heat that can make the scalp feel unpleasantly hot or even tender during blow-drying.

Commanding the Elements: Personalized Hair Care

Further empowering the user, the dryer offers a range of settings: two speeds (High for robust airflow, Low for a gentler touch) and three heat options (Hot, Warm, and Cool). This allows for customization based on hair type (fine hair might prefer lower heat, while thicker hair might initially need higher heat), a particular stage of drying (starting hotter, finishing cooler), or styling preference. The crucial Cool Shot button delivers a blast of cool air to help set your style, close down those hair cuticles further after heat styling, and add an extra boost of shine – a trick well-known to professional stylists.

The Little Things That Matter: Design Details that Speak Volumes

Beyond the headline technologies, thoughtful design elements contribute to the overall user experience and the longevity of the appliance.

  • The Unsung Hero – The Removable Filter: At the air intake, a filter prevents dust, lint, and stray hairs from being sucked into the motor. The EH-ANA6HN features an easily removable and wipeable filter. Regular cleaning of this filter is crucial. A clogged filter restricts airflow, forcing the motor to work harder, reducing efficiency, and potentially leading to overheating. Keeping it clean ensures your dryer performs optimally and safely for longer – a small maintenance step with big returns.
  • Safety First – The Silent Guardians: Peace of mind is built-in with features like an ALCI (Appliance Leakage Current Interrupter) safety plug, designed to prevent electric shock if the dryer comes into contact with water – a vital feature for any bathroom appliance. Additionally, an automatic overheating protection mechanism is in place; if the dryer’s internal temperature exceeds a safe limit, it will typically switch to a cool air mode or shut off, preventing damage to the appliance and reducing fire risk.
